Transaction 3cdd44fe8b8f599a046e56bdd6fd4b3ffb97ed12e6c1adeba42130735319e1bf

94 Input
2 Outputs
  • 3cdd44fe8b8f599a046e56bdd6fd4b3ffb97ed12e6c1adeba42130735319e1bf:0
  • value  829223
    address  3FLC6spSKo34c5hgdYMcejMeWa4eSKXvfw
  • 3cdd44fe8b8f599a046e56bdd6fd4b3ffb97ed12e6c1adeba42130735319e1bf:1
  • value  5306323762
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s